Winter Storm Update 1/23/2025
The weather conditions continue to pose issues for our roads. As expected, the roads experienced re-freezing overnight, and the same is expected for tonight (January 23) as the temperatures are expected to be below freezing once again. The National Weather Service has noted that another Cold Weather Advisory may be issued later today. Please keep up-to-date on weather conditions by using this link: NWS Charleston, SC - Weather Briefing
Palmetto Boulevard and our side streets still have snow/ice, as does Highway 174 and the McKinley Washington Jr. Bridge. SCDOT is doing what it can, but these areas have not been plowed or treated yet. DOT is planning to plow and treat these roads either later today or tomorrow morning.
